A total of now 14 people in Wisconsin have been tested for coronavirus — including a patient who on Thursday became the 12th person confirmed as having it, a state health official said Friday.
The confirmed patient, from Dane County, contracted the deadly virus while in China to celebrate the Chinese New Year. He remains isolated at home and is “making a very good recovery,” said Tom Haupt, an epidemiologist with the Wisconsin Department of Health Services.
Five other people are still awaiting test results. Results for the other eight came back negative, officials said.
